Mustang Print: Your Lover in Substantial-Good quality Printing Methods
When you are searhing for offering major-notch printing providers, Mustang Print stands as staying a dependable name in the market. Situated in Australia, this company has founded itself staying a leader in delivering several different printing methods that focus on both equally specific and little organization. Whether you drive vibrant enterprise